LAGUNA BEACH, CA — All five Laguna Beach City councilmembers gave Orange County Sup. Katrina Foley endorsements for her bid to be reelected to the Board of Supervisors, the Laguna Beach Indy reported.

According to the Laguna Beach Indy, Mayor Sue Kempf, Mayor Pro Tem Bob Whalen, Councilmember Toni Iseman, Councilmember Peter Blake and Councilmember George Weiss authored statements recommending Foley for her bid in the Fifth District Supervisor race.

The newly-drawn district runs along the coast from Newport Beach to San Clemente, reaching inland as far as Rancho Santa Margarita.

While county supervisor is a non-partisan elected position, Foley has also received endorsements from the Democratic Party of Orange County and the Laguna Beach Democratic Club, the outlet reported.

Foley's challengers include Sen. Patricia Bates (R-Laguna Niguel), former Dana Point mayor and councilmember Diane Harkey, and Newport Beach councilmember Kevin Muldoon. Current Fifth District Supervisor Lisa Bartlett is terming out of office and currently running as a Republican for the 49th Congressional District.
